SendPulse Popup API

The Popup API from SendPulse — 5 operation(s) for popup.

Operations 5

GET /public/api/popups/conditions Get a list of available display conditions for popups #
GET /public/api/popups/list/quiz/{projectId} Get a list of quiz pop-ups by your project ID #
GET /public/api/popups/list/{projectId} Get a list of pop-ups by your project ID #
POST /public/api/popups/{popupId}/set-state Set a pop-up state #
DELETE /public/api/popups/{popupId} Delete popup #

  /public/api/popups/{popupId}/set-state:
    post:
      tags:
      - Popup
      summary: Set a pop-up state
      description: Enables or disables a pop-up on your website
      parameters:
      - name: popupId
        in: path
        description: Pop-up ID. It can be obtained using the "Get a list of projects" method or in the pop-up builder address bar in your account.
        schema:
          type: string
          format: uuid
        required: true
      requestBody:
        content:
          application/json:
            schema:
              properties:
                is_enabled:
                  type: boolean
                  description: Sets a pop-up state. If you want to enable your pop-up, pass "true", and if you want to disable it, pass "false".
              type: object
      responses:
        '200':
          description: Operation successful
          content:
            application/json:
              schema:
                properties:
                  result:
                    type: boolean
                  data:
                    $ref: '#/components/schemas/popup'
                type: object
        '400':
          description: Validation error
          content:
            application/json:
              example:
                result: false
                errors:
                  id: Invalid id {{'af1b0e2a-bff9-4d09-a7d9-99d61d2b43b'}}
                  isEnabled: Invalid boolean value '23'
        '401':
          $ref: '#/components/schemas/unauthorizedResponse'
        '404':
          description: Resource Not Found
      operationId: setPopupState
      x-ai-role: conversion_optimization_specialist
      x-ai-description: Controls the live visibility of a pop-up on the target website. Toggling a pop-up state is a high-impact, instantly effective action — enabling it starts showing the pop-up to visitors immediately, while disabling it suppresses it without deleting any configuration or accumulated statistics. Use this as the primary on/off switch for campaigns, A/B tests, or seasonal promotions.
      x-ai-reasoning-instructions:
      - Confirm the popupId exists and belongs to the user's account before toggling — an invalid UUID will produce a 400 error.
      - Before enabling, consider whether the pop-up is part of an active A/B test or scheduled campaign to avoid unintended conflicts.
      - If the user wants to temporarily pause a pop-up (e.g., during site maintenance), prefer disabling over deleting — all settings and stats are preserved.
      - Verify the boolean value is strictly true or false, not a string like '1' or 'yes', as the API rejects non-boolean values.
      x-ai-responding-instructions:
      - 'Confirm the new state explicitly: ''Pop-up has been enabled / disabled successfully.'''
      - If enabling, mention that the pop-up will now be visible to website visitors immediately.
      - If disabling, reassure the user that the pop-up configuration and statistics are preserved and it can be re-enabled at any time.
      - On a 404 error, suggest verifying the popupId via the 'Get a list of projects' endpoint.
      x-ai-suggestions:
      - 'To enable: set is_enabled to true'
      - 'To pause a campaign without losing data: set is_enabled to false'
      - Follow up with 'Get a list of projects' to verify the updated state
      x-ai-capabilities:
        confirmation:
          type: Recommended
          message: This will immediately change the pop-up visibility on the live website. Confirm the intended state (enable/disable).
        security_info:
          data_handling:
          - ResourceStateUpdate
